WebThe polar covalent bond is the bond in which the electrons shared among the elements have a difference of electronegativity between 0.5 and 2.0. Table of Content Types of covalent … WebNon-polar bonds are also a type of covalent bond. Unlike polar bonds, non-polar bonds share electrons equally. A bond between two atoms or more atoms is non-polar if the atoms have the same electronegativity or a difference in electronegativities that is less than 0.4. WebMar 28, 2024 · A polar covalent bond is a covalent bond in which the atoms have an unequal attraction for electrons, so the electrons are shared unequally. In a polar covalent bond, sometimes simply called a polar bond, the distribution of electrons around the molecule is no longer symmetrical. WebPure vs. Polar Covalent Bonds. If the atoms that form a covalent bond are identical, as in H 2, Cl 2, and other diatomic molecules, then the electrons in the bond must be shared equally. We refer to this as a pure covalent bond. Electrons shared in pure covalent bonds have an equal probability of being near each nucleus.
